@iml6yu 使用 devise 即可,两者都可实现 https://github.com/plataformatec/devise
有人建议我用一部分钱去 lobby 中国政府把 Github 彻底封了……
帮我问候他家所有人!
可以啊。 用 byebug https://github.com/deivid-rodriguez/byebug
修改成 https
append 两个文件 修改一个文件 新增一个文件
@string2020 then, reboot your system.
you may try
rvm reset
超级赞的公司
class AddIndexToUsersEmail < ActiveRecord::Migration
def change
add_index :users, :studentsid
add_index :users, :email
end
end
add_index 没有指定 table_name
就差一天就用上了,最后用了 ransack
homebrew 应该没什么影响。
@agilejzl ,应该是东京吧
听过叫做 yaml_db 的 gem,不过貌似不维护了
安装文档只是浪费时间
怎么提交代码?
comment 和 tag 都要有个属性 post_id 查询@comment.post_id,就能找到是哪个 post 了。
对 activeadmin 好感略少
问题 1:你觉得什么是优雅的代码?分享一下你认为优雅的 Ruby 代码。
class Cart
has_many :orders
belongs_to :user
end
问题 2:接触 Ruby 后,你的编程环境有什么变化?例如,不用 IDE,而是用文本编辑器写代码;弃用了爱用多年的 Windows,投向了 Linux 甚至苹果的怀抱。 原来是 vs,现在是 Fedora + Sublime 问题 3:你用 Ruby 做过提高工作效率的小工具(Gem)吗?你的 Ruby 最佳实践是什么? 基本每个 gem 都是为了节省时间或者精力。
devise
thin
cancancan
capistrano
rspec
今天就参照这个教程完成了工作,尤其是最后的 ssh-copy-id,非常有效。 感谢!
最简单的办法是,首先在 shared/config/里面手工写 database.yml 文件。 这个文件一经写入,就不会更改。
cap 每次会在 current/config/database.yml 与这个文件之间建立 link,这个就不用担心了。
真没人注意到标题的 bundler 写错了?
明显是 git push -f 啊
对初学者而言,可能真的有问题。
不说别的,就那个 bootstraper 就让我觉得头大。
初学者一次不要学那么多技巧啦。
@chenge 你不会也有色弱吧
what's new error messages?